6.2.3.3.3.6. Scale calibration
The scale calibration menu allows you to select which scale you want to create. I.e. Focus,
Iris or Zoom. Initially, all scales will be illuminated in red and the “save” function (MB2)
will be grayed out. The scales will only illuminate green after assigning at least one value
for each scale. It is only possible to save the lens file when each axis (with an assigned
motor) is green.
Note: If you do not have a motor connected and assigned to iris and zoom, you must enter
at least one value for each corresponding scale. Please enter the open iris value for the iris
scale and the focal length of your prime lens in the zoom scale.
6.2.3.3.3.7. Focus scale
In general, you can start creating the focus scale from either direction. In this example
however, the lens is being created from infinity to close focus.
Move the control interface assigned to focus (knob as default) until the datum line on your
lens matches infinity.
Use the thumb wheel to scroll clockwise or counter-clockwise until you see “inf” in the
blue input box. As an alternative, you can also swipe the touch screen up or down.
Once “inf” is highlighted in the blue input box, press “set” (MB2) and the infinity mark will
be set on the grafical scale bar. As an alternative, you can also tap the touch screen to
confirm your selection or press the back button (BB1).
